Playwright Samuel D. Hunter has been an acclaimed scribe of the Off-Broadway scene for many years. In 2025, Hunter finally made his Broadway debut with “Little Bear Ridge Road,” a play about the relationship between an aunt and her estranged nephew who hole up together during the COVID-19 pandemic.
Like many of his other works, “Little Bear Ridge Road” is a quiet drama. In the below episode, Hunter explained his affinity towards humble stories and writing a role specifically for Tony Award winner Laurie Metcalf.
“Little Bear Ridge Road” is nominated for one Tony Award.

The 2026 Tony Awards will take place on June 7 at Radio City Music Hall. P!NK will host the ceremony, which will be broadcast live on CBS and streamed on Paramount+ (8 p.m. ET/5 p.m. PT). CBS and Pluto TV will present the Tony Awards: Act One, with additional details to follow.
